Gisele Bundchen Stars in Videos for Rio+20

Rio de Janeiro, Brazil –  The Brazilian model and UN Environment Program Goodwill Ambassador Gisele Bundchen filmed these two videos for the UN Secretary General’s Sustainable Energy for All initiative.

One of the key goals of the initiative is to bring clean energy solutions to people living in poor communities around the world. To that end, the Global Alliance for Clean Cookstoves is an important player. The Global Alliance is a public private partnership between governments, NGOs and the private sector that seeks to reduce people’s exposure to harmful indoor cooking smoke by replacing old, unhealthy cook stoves with cleaner burning alternatives.

It’s  a project that is good for the environment and good for people’s health and welfare.

In these two videos, released at the United Nations Conference on Sustainable Development (also known as Rio+20) this week, Gisele explains the urgency and importance of clean cookstoves.
